Skip to content
Snippets Groups Projects

Plot horizon distance from ranking statistics

Merged ChiWai Chan requested to merge plot_psd_horizon into master
1 unresolved thread
1 file
+ 7
10
Compare changes
  • Side-by-side
  • Inline
+ 7
10
@@ -21,16 +21,13 @@ from optparse import OptionParser
import sys
import lal
from ligo.lw import lsctables, ligolw
from ligo.lw import utils as ligolw_utils
from ligo.lw.utils import segments as ligolw_segments
from gstlal import datasource
from gstlal import multirate_datasource
from gstlal import pipeparts
from gstlal import simplehandler
from gstlal.psd import read_psd
from gstlal.stream import Stream
from ligo.lw.utils import segments as ligolw_segments
from ligo.lw import lsctables, ligolw
### This program will play data in a variety of ways
###
@@ -211,16 +208,16 @@ elif options.low_pass_filter is not None:
# necessary audio convert and amplify
stream = stream.audioamplify(options.amplification).audioconvert()
if options.sample_format is not None:
stream.stream.capsfilter(f"audio/x-raw, format={options.sample_format}")
stream = stream.capsfilter(f"audio/x-raw, format={options.sample_format}")
if options.output is None:
stream.autoaudiosink()
elif options.output.endswith(".wav"):
stream.wavenc().filefink(options.output)
stream.wavenc().filesink(options.output)
elif options.output.endswith(".flac"):
stream.flacenc().filefink(options.output)
stream.flacenc().filesink(options.output)
elif options.output.endswith(".ogg"):
stream.vorbisenc().oggmux().filefink(options.output)
stream.vorbisenc().oggmux().filesink(options.output)
elif options.output.endswith(".txt") or options.output in ("/dev/stdout", "/dev/stderr"):
stream.nxydumpsink(options.output)
else:
Loading